在现代编程环境中,Visual Studio Code(简称VSCode)已经成为许多开发者的首选编辑器。它不仅功能强大,且适用于多种编程语言和技术。然而,许多开发者在使用VSCode时,可能会发现他们在终端中执行代码时的结果输出并不如预期。下面,我们将详细探讨如何在VSCode的终端中正确显示结果,让开发过程更加流畅。
1. 配置VSCode终端
首先,确保您已经正确配置了VSCode的终端。默认情况下,VSCode应该会使用您计算机上的命令行工具,如cmd
、PowerShell
或bash
。如果终端配置不当,可能会导致您无法看到代码的输出。
1.1 访问终端设置
要检查终端配置,请点击右下角的设置图标,或者通过快捷键Ctrl + ,
调出设置界面。接着,搜索“终端”以找到相关设置。在这里,您可以选择默认终端类型,比如选择cmd
还是bash
。
1.2 测试终端
配置完成后,您可以打开终端来测试。可以通过快捷键Ctrl + `
打开终端。在终端中输入echo Hello World
,如果您看到期望的结果,那么终端配置是正确的。
2. 正确运行代码
在终端设置好之后,您需要学会如何在VSCode中正确运行代码,以确保结果能够显示在终端中。这通常包括选择正确的运行方式和相关命令。
2.1 使用内置调试器
VSCode提供了很强大的调试功能。通过在代码的左侧添加断点并选择运行代码,您可以在终端中看到运行结果。在调试视图中,您可以配置调试器,以便更好地控制如何执行代码。
2.2 直接运行脚本
对于Python等语言,您可以直接在终端中运行脚本。例如,输入python your_script.py
,这将在终端中显示脚本的输出结果。如果遇到权限问题,请检查文件的可执行权限。
3. 使用任务管理输出
除了直接在终端中运行命令,VSCode还允许您通过任务管理器
来执行脚本并查看输出。这一功能对于需要频繁执行特定任务的开发者非常有用。
3.1 创建任务配置
要创建新的任务,您可以在命令面板中输入Tasks: Configure Task
,然后选择创建任务
。接下来,您可以根据要求配置任务,如指定命令和参数。
3.2 运行任务
配置完成后,您可以通过命令面板运行任务,或者使用快捷键Ctrl + Shift + B
来执行默认任务。在终端中,您将能够看到运行的结果,包括错误信息和调试信息。
4. 常见问题及解决方法
在使用VSCode终端时,您可能会遇到一些常见问题。了解这些问题及其解决方法能够帮助您更好地使用VSCode。
4.1 输出没有反应
如果您在终端中运行代码时没有任何输出,请首先检查您是否正确选择了目标文件。确保在终端中进入了正确的目录,并且文件路径没有错误。
4.2 终端显示乱码
如果您在终端中看到乱码,可能是由于编码问题。您可以在文件置入完毕后,通过设置文件编码为UTF-8来解决此问题。具体可以通过右下角的编码设置进行更改。
5. 小技巧提高终端效率
通过一些简单的技巧,您可以大大提高在VSCode中使用终端的效率,帮助您更快地调试和运行代码。
5.1 使用快捷键
熟悉VSCode的快捷键是提高您的工作效率的重要手段。例如,使用Ctrl + C
可以快速终止正在执行的程序,而Ctrl + K
则可以清空终端内容。
5.2 多终端使用
VSCode支持多个终端同时运行,这意味着您可以同时运行不同的程序或任务。在终端选项中,可以通过+按钮
来添加新的终端,从而实时监控不同进程的输出。
通过以上的讲解,希望您能在VSCode的终端中顺利显示结果,提升您的编程体验。善用终端,让您的开发过程更加高效和愉悦。